Features
The SMC™-3 smart controller is a compact, simple to use, solid-state motor controller designed to operate 3-phase motors. It has a built-in overload relay and a built-in SCR bypass contactor on all three phases, allowing a smaller footprint than other soft starters on the market. Modes of operation for the controller include soft start, soft stop, current limit start, and kick start. These soft starters are available as part of the Enclosed SMC product family.
Standards: UL 508 listed, CSA C22.2 number 14 certified, EN/IEC 60947-1, EN/IEC 60947-4-2, cULus listed (file number E96956, Guides NMFT, NMFT7), CE marked, CCC certified
Applications: For use with line-connected motors
